Virginia's
premiere "Rails to Trails" project is an impressive feat
nearly as impressive as the route itself. The 57 mile trail follows
the former path of the Norfolk Southern Railroad. It passes through
the rolling green hills of the Virginia high country and follows
the New River for 39 miles. Stretching from Pulaski, Va to Galax,
Va, the gentle grade makes this a very easy hike. By using a map
and good planning, you can plan a hike that includes camping as
well as stays in Bed and Breakfast's. There are secluded sections
and a sporadic supply of filterable drinking water, so planning
is an integral part of a hike here.
